European Leaders Emphasize Ukraine’s Autonomy in Peace Negotiations

Brussels: European leaders stressed in a joint statement that the path to peace in Ukraine “cannot be decided without Ukraine.”

According to Qatar News Agency, the statement came as US President Donald Trump and Russian President Vladimir Putin arranged to meet in Alaska on Friday. The joint statement from British, French, Italian, German, Polish, and Finnish leaders and the president of the European Commission emphasized that “the current line of contact should be the starting point of negotiations.’

“Ukraine has the freedom of choice over its own destiny. Meaningful negotiations can only take place in the context of a ceasefire or reduction of hostilities. The path to peace in Ukraine cannot be decided without Ukraine. We remain committed to the principle that international borders must not be changed by force,” the European leaders said in the statement.

They also acknowledged Trump’s efforts “to stop the killing in Ukraine, end the Russian Federation’s war of aggression, and achieve just and lasting peace and security for Ukraine.”

The leaders expressed their readiness to support these efforts diplomatically, as well as through continued military and financial aid to Ukraine. The statement also highlighted the need for robust and credible security guarantees that enable Ukraine to effectively defend its sovereignty and territorial integrity, reaffirming their “unwavering commitment to Ukraine’s sovereignty, independence, and territorial integrity.”
